| Style | Example Podcasts | Key Design Elements |
|---|---|---|
| Guest Portrait | Joe Rogan, Lex Fridman | Headshot focus, minimal branding, dark backgrounds |
| Studio Shot | H3 Podcast, Flagrant | Both host and guest, studio environment, energy |
| Topic-Driven | Diary of a CEO, Impact Theory | Bold topic text, guest photo, inspirational design |
| Clip/Moment | Podcast clips channels | Reaction screenshots, quote overlays, emotional peaks |

Podcast Thumbnail Design
🎤 Guest Recognition
The guest IS the thumbnail. Their face, fame, and reputation drive clicks more than any other element in podcast thumbnails.
🎨 Brand Consistency
Template-based designs with consistent logos, fonts, and color schemes build recognition across hundreds of episodes.
💬 Conversation Moments
Capturing emotional or intense conversation moments through facial expressions creates intrigue about what was discussed.
📝 Topic Hooks
Provocative topic text overlays help when guests aren't instantly recognizable. The topic becomes the primary click driver.
